Based on Frances Hodson Burnett's popular children's book and stage play, this lavish Victorian drama features Shirley Temple in her first Technicolor film. The
irresistibly charming Temple stars as Sara Crewe, a wealthy young girl who is enrolled at a prestigious boarding school while her father, Captain Reginald
Crewe (Ian Hunter), is away in Africa fighting in the Boer War. After Sara receives news of her father's sudden death, the cruel and envious headmistress of the
school, Amanda Minchin (Mary Nash), proceeds to make life miserable for the now penniless girl. Sara is forced to work in servitude in the school's kitchen, but
deep in her heart she knows that her father is still alive. She soon escapes from Mrs. Minchin's clutches and begins the seemingly impossible search for the
missing Captain Crewe.

Shirley Temple in a role that seems custom-made for her, portrays the spirited young heroine of the popular children's novel, giving her a rich emotional depth
and infinite charm. When her aunt tires of caring for her, orphan Heidi is taken into the Swiss mountains to live with her gruff grandfather (Jean Hersholt), a
hermit who comes to adore her. But the aunt returns to steal Heidi away, selling her to a family whose invalid daughter (Marcia Mae Jones) needs a companion.
Bullied by an evil governess (Mary Nash), Heidi still charms the entire household and never stops trying to return to her beloved grandfather.
